WASHINGTONThe American Hotel & Lodging Association (AHLA) announced the appointment of Kevin Carey to serve as the AHLA Foundations president and CEO, effective immediately. Carey, who will continue to serve as chief operating officer (COO) of AHLA, succeeds Anna Blue, who announced her departure in February.
